Polling suspended in Cox’s Bazar centre

Polling has been suspended at a centre in Kutubdia Upazila in Cox’s Bazar.

The decision followed after two young men were shot at while trying to snatch a ballot box from the Kutubdia Paschim Lemshikhali Government Primary School centre on Sunday, said Zafar Alam, Additional Deputy Commissioner (Revenue) of Cox’s Bazar.

Supporters of BNP-Jamaat backed candidates tried to raid the centre and snatch the ballot box, said Lemshikhali Union Parishad Chairman Aktar Hossain.

Police fired at them, leaving two injured.
Cox’s Bazar’s Additional Superintendent of Police Tofail Ahmed said additional policemen had been deployed at the centre after the incident.
Earlier, police detained three persons on charges of rigging votes at a centre.
